MS Dhoni is the captain of Chennai Super Kings again: What and why of a dramatic move?

24 March 2022MS Dhoni stepped down as the captain of Chennai Super Kings two days before the start of IPL. The sudden announcement shocked the fans and an emotional tribute will soon follow. We were told that Dhoni had handed over the captaincy to Ravindra Jadeja. CSK started the season as the defending champions and then lost the first match to Kolkata Knight Riders. The only silver lining in that defeat was MS Dhoni’s half-century.

April 30, 2022: After a while, CSK are out of the race for a place in the playoffs after six losses in eight matches. Dhoni’s successor Ravindra Jadeja has had a terrible time both as captain and as a player. He has never been exceptional in the IPL – his best season with the ball is 2014 when he took 19 wickets and has scored only two half-centuries in 208 matches. But in 2022, Jadeja looked completely different. Between Gujarat Titans’ victory over Royal Challengers Bangalore and the start of the RR-MI match, CSK said Jadeja handed the captaincy back to MS Dhoni, who accepted the responsibility again in the larger interest of the team.

During CSK’s loss this summer, MS Dhoni’s form with the bat has been the only silver lining. An unbeaten 29 to beat Mumbai Indians will be a part of cricket’s folklore for years to come. There is Mukesh Choudhary to talk to in the CSK camp, but never mind. “Mahi maar raha hai” is starting to sound like an ad campaign for India’s most famous captain.

Looking at the past one month and the performance of CSK in the IPL, you would almost feel sorry for Ravindra Jadeja, one of the best all-rounders in world cricket. Just before the start of the season, Jadeja punished Sri Lanka with an unbeaten 175 and then took 9 wickets in Tests to give India a massive victory.

In the IPL, Ravindra Jadeja looks lost, confused and like a man in the shadow of his more illustrious predecessor.

It is not easy to beat MS Dhoni. It is almost impossible and Jadeja failed to do so.

Ravindra Jadeja also failed to do the same. As MS Dhoni walks away after winning the win over MI, Jadeja takes off his cap and bows to the maestro. It was probably more than symbolic.

On the field it often seemed that Jadeja had succumbed to the wishes of MS Dhoni. Dhoni changed the field placements, talked to the bowlers and the TV cameras never gave up to agree to the DRS call. Of course, during CSK’s misery, Jadeja was left to speak to the media, broadcasters at the toss and post-match presentation ceremonies.

It was tough being Ravindra Jadeja all these weeks. It must be really suffocating.

In the end, it was too much to bear and with five matches remaining, Jadeja decided to hand over the captain’s badge back to MS Dhoni, who duly obliged.

But here are some points to consider as CSK look set to take on Sunrisers Hyderabad in a big way.

Captains have often struggled in the IPL. Virat Kohli has struggled. Rohit Sharma is struggling. Mayank Agarwal has experienced ups and downs in his first stint as captain. But how many captains have stepped down after nine matches and have given up their position to the person who previously held the job?

It is possible that Jadeja did not enjoy the responsibilities at all. But wouldn’t MS Dhoni have tried to persuade him to stay on for just three more weeks and re-evaluate his position after the season?

More importantly, how many decisions are approved in the CSK camp without MS Dhoni’s seal? And was it really Jadeja’s decision?

There are questions and more to come as the story unfolds over the next few days, but the answer is anyone’s guess.

During those nine matches under Ravindra Jadeja, you almost got the feeling that he was just going through the motions and that MS Dhoni’s decision to step down as captain was only on papers. CSK released some of their stars, including Faf du Plessis, who took over as the captain of RCB. The young players – Ruturaj Gaikwad, Shivam Dubey, Mukesh Choudhary and many others – look at MSD like a cult figure.

Then there is Dwayne Bravo who has played under MS Dhoni for so many years. Robin Uthappa is an old friend. Maybe even Jadeja is surprised. Taking over from Dhoni and making it his team was not easy for anyone, not even one of the best players in the world.

Whatever the reason, this U-turn shows CSK in a bad light. At the end of a horror season, this is the kind of drama they could have done without. The Super Kings could still change that, winning their next five matches and presenting a serious case for the playoffs, but what about the image of the second most successful IPL team in history?
